Sevti is a cross-cultural given name with two main etymologies. In South Asian usage, it is a clipped form of Marathi/Hindi Shevanti/Sevanti, the name of the chrysanthemum; by extension it conveys associations of autumn blooms, endurance, and grace. Another line of derivation appears in the Balkans and Turkish-influenced communities, where Sevti is read against the Turkish verb sevmek “to love” (root sev-), aligning the name’s sense with “beloved, affectionate,” alongside related names such as Sevgi, Sevil, and Sevtap.
Documented as a feminine name in 20th‑century Maharashtra and later among Indian diasporas, Sevti also occurs sporadically as a modern nickname or standalone given name in parts of the Balkans and among Turkish speakers. Variants and cognates include Shevanti/Sevanti, Sevdiye, Sevgi, Sevil, and Sevtap; short forms like Sevi or Vanti are common. Usage is rare overall, lending Sevti a distinctive, contemporary feel.
